Transcode farm (Burlwood cluster) account recovery. If the scheduler account locks after three failed auth attempts, stop all worker pulls first. Then open the Ferrox admin shell on the coordinator node and run the unlock routine. Do not rotate keys mid-recovery. The routine will prompt for the recovery passphrase, shown here:

unlock words, hahip-baduf: holwyn-istath-julvan

## Who to ping about GraphWeaver

If you're on call and GraphWeaver (our dependency graph visualizer) starts rendering blank canvases or timing out on big graphs, don't panic. Nine times out of ten it's the layout worker choking on the Pemberton monorepo's cyclic imports. Restart the worker pool first. If that doesn't fix it, the Graph Tooling squad owns this — Marisol is the current point person and she's pretty responsive during Harwick office hours. Reach her team here.

escalation mailbox, bafog-fafog: ulador@paliqlabs.internal

= Transport of the Locked Test-Device Case =

The grey Pelham-style case holds the calibration units for the Strayfield pilot and must remain locked at all times in transit. Records team: before dispatch, verify the seal number against the devices register, photograph the seal, and file both under the transport log. The case travels alone — never consolidated with other freight — and is carried by Thornquay Secure Couriers on a same-day run. At collection, the accompanying instruction governs the courier hand-over.

courier memo of yawep-yafog: the pramir ulaix courier leaves the ulavan aldix frair zorok oliiel joreth rusdor fenvan ledger at gate 1305 under passcode 514738

## 2.14.0 — Hermetic build migration

We rotated the release signing key as part of moving the Fenwick build onto the new hermetic build system. All dependencies are now pinned and fetched from the internal mirror, so builds no longer touch the network at compile time. The old key was revoked once the last legacy pipeline was retired. New team members should verify artifacts against the current key, shown below.

rollout seal: bky4_x7Gc